Spud, it's not that simple. Both ends of the triangular profile are beveled, and the nominal diameter of the thread is not measured at the tips of the triangles (Dmaj+H/8), but the actual height of the external thread (Dmaj), so the math is a bit more complex. The drill diameter is Dmin here.
